US mass shooting: Two killed, nine wounded at Brown University

Law enforcement officials walk near an entrance to Brown University during the investigation of a mass shooting, Providence, Rhode Island, December 13, 2025. (Photo by AP)

Two students have been killed and nine others critically injured in a shooting at Brown University, prompting a campus-wide lockdown and a manhunt for the suspect.

Exams were underway on Saturday when an active shooter entered the Ivy League campus in Providence, Rhode Island, United States. 

The university issued its first emergency alert around 4:22 pm local time (21:22 GMT), warning of a gunman near the Barus and Holley engineering and physics building.

“Lock doors, silence phones and stay hidden until further notice. Remember: RUN, if you are in the affected location, evacuate safely if you can; HIDE, if evacuation is not possible, take cover; FIGHT, as a last resort, take action to protect yourself,” the university said in the update.

Providence Mayor Brett Smiley confirmed the initial casualties at a news conference: “I can confirm that there are two individuals who have died this afternoon, and there are another eight in critical status, though stable, at Rhode Island Hospital.”

“Those are the only injuries or casualties that we know at this time but, as I mentioned, and it is important to remind folks, these numbers may change. We are still in the early hours,” he added.

A few hours later, the number of injured rose to nine, Smiley said, including one more victim who had left the scene and later discovered they had sustained non-life-threatening wounds from gunfire.

Rhode Island authorities said the suspect is still at large. He is described as a man dressed in black who fled the campus on foot, and no weapons have been recovered so far.

Smiley declined to identify the victims, stressing that the investigation is ongoing. He reassured the community even as a shelter-in-place order remained in effect for Brown University and the surrounding neighborhood.

Saturday’s shooting marks the second major gun violence incident on a US university campus this week.

On Tuesday, a shooter opened fire at Kentucky State University in Frankfort, killing one student and leaving another critically injured.
